性能测试服务使用流程
准备资源组
准备运行性能测试的测试资源组。
说明:
测试资源组包含共享资源组和私有资源组两种类型,共享资源组为系统默认提供,私有资源组需要自行创建。
创建步骤
1、登录PerfTest控制台,在左侧导航栏中选择“测试资源”,单击“创建私有资源组”。
2、(可选)首次使用时,请根据提示信息,授权PerfTest创建私有资源组。
3、进入创建资源组页面后,如果是首次使用没有云容器引擎服务CCE集群,需要先执行4创建集群然后再创建资源组。如果已有可用的云容器引擎服务CCE集群,直接执行5创建资源组。
4、创建集群。
单击页面上方的“创建集群”,进入购买CCE集群页面。创建集群操作请参考购买CCE集群,设置集群参数。
5、创建资源组。
创建测试工程
为用户的测试工程提供管理能力,事务、测试任务、测试报告的内容在同一个工程内共享。
操作步骤
1、登录PerfTest控制台,选择左侧导航栏的“PerfTest测试工程”,单击“创建测试工程”。
2、在弹出的“创建测试工程”对话框中,输入测试工程的名称,例如“Web-test”和相关描述,单击“确定”。
创建测试任务
根据压测场景,引用定义好的测试事务,为用户创建性能测试场景。
操作步骤
1、登录PerfTest控制台,选择左侧导航栏的“PerfTest测试工程”。
2、在PerfTest测试工程所在行,单击测试工程名称,例如前面创建的测试工程“Web-test”,进入测试工程详情页面。
3、选择“测试任务”页签,单击“创建任务”。
4、输入任务名称,例如“taskA”,选择执行方式。
5、单击“添加用例”,在弹出的对话框中选择已创建好用例,单击“确定”。
6、配置完成后,单击“保存”。
查看测试报告
提供性能测试的实时报告和离线报告,用于测试结果分析。
操作步骤
1、登录PerfTest控制台,选择左侧导航栏的“PerfTest测试工程”。
2、在PerfTest测试工程所在行,单击测试工程名称,例如前面创建的测试工程“Web-test”,进入测试工程详情页面。
3、在“测试任务”页签,选择测试任务,如前面创建的测试任务“taskA”,单击操作栏的右三角按钮。
4、选择企业项目和资源组类型,单击“执行”,启动测试任务。
5、任务启动后,单击“查看报告”会自动跳转到实时报告页面。
您也可以在压测任务结束后,单击测试任务“taskA”的操作栏的,查看按钮查看离线报告页面。
在测试报告总览页面单击右上角的“下载离线报告”,获得PDF版本,联系专家进行分析,分析出当前系统的性能瓶颈以及改进建议。
操作约束
如果使用PerfTest服务压测公共网站,需确保该公共网站对于压测者是白名单,否则一切法律后果需自负。
切换新旧版本界面
本文档对功能操作和截图说明基于“新版界面”。
如果您当前在旧版界面,请返回PerfTest控制台,进入总览页,单击页面右上方的“体验新版”。
性能测试 CodeArts PerfTest相关视频
性能测试
性能测试
性能测试服务精选推荐
1对1咨询专属顾问
华为云咨询电话:950808或4000-955-988 转1
华为云咨询电话:950808或4000-955-988 转1